Original story...
PG&E has announced that there might be more power shut-offs again this week. Due to high winds in the forecast and low humidity, blackouts may occur in seventeen Sierra Foothills and North Bay Counties including (but not limited to): Amador, Butte, Colusa, El Dorado, Lake, Marin, Mendocino, Napa, Nevada, Placer, Plumas, San Joaquin, Solano, Sonoma, Tehama, Yolo, and Yuba counties.
If the shut-off happens, it's expected to take place Wednesday afternoon through midday Thursday (18-24 hours) and will be of a lesser scope than the blackout we experienced earlier this month.
